At the table, dummy won and another heart was led. West won heartA, cashed heartQ to extract declarer's last trump and continued with a club. While East cashed his clubs, West ditched all his diamonds and the only remaining trick that South could muster was heart9 in dummy, West's hand being high.

5heart was seven light or 2000 (in old scoring) to East-West. South got greedy. If he abandons trumps when in with spadeK and simply plays on diamonds the result would have been at least 1500 less catastrophic.

Ten tricks are straightfoward with diamonds as trumps, and at the other table South chalked up +130.
